I have seen some other posts about this, but not seen one with a fix. This looks like a bug.
When I login to PowerBI online, I can see a Personal Gatway connection that I set up on a Laptop some time ago. This particular connection was just a test, and I no longer want it. There is no option however to remove it.
I have setup a new personal gateway on a fixed PC, as this is the one that I now want to use, but this one is not visible or selectable from the Gateway Connection Screen.
Does anyone have an idea of how to fix this, or know if Microsoft can assist with the issue at all?
After you setup a new personal gateway on a new PC, make sure the status is Connected when you click the personal gateway icon in the right corner of windows task bar. At this time, go to the dataset settings in Power BI Service, the machine name shown there will be changed from your laptop to your new PC automatically. Actually you do not need to remove it.
